  Annotations were created to evaluate the [kabr-tools pipeline](https://github.com/Imageomics/kabr-tools) and conduct case studies on Grevy's landscape of fear and inter-species spatial distribution. Annotations include manual detections and tracks, mini-scenes cut from source videos, behavior annotations from an X3D action recognition model, and associated drone telemetry data. The detections contain bounding box coordinates, image file names, and class labels for each annotated animal. Annotations were created using [CVAT](https://www.cvat.ai/) to manually draw bounding boxes around animals in a selection of raw drone videos. The annotations were then exported as xml files and used to create the provided mini-scenes. The [KABR X3D model](https://huggingface.co/imageomics/x3d-kabr-kinetics) was used to label the mini-scenes with predicted behaviors. Telemetry data was exported from [Airdata](https://airdata.com/).
